Check out the wiki on the website (or buy the book, it's worth it) and
look under Customisation.
 
Or copy all of /opt/rt3/share to /opt/rt3/local, and modify what you
copied. 
 
But you will probably find it is worth spending the time doing some
little reading, since you'll learn how to do cusomisation is such a way
as it doesn't get over-written with minor version changes. (There's a
topic on the Wiki called something like CleanlyCustomizeRT).
